OpenAI files for IPO; UK lawyers question AI court assistants

OpenAI has reportedly filed confidentially for an Initial Public Offering, signaling a potential landmark market debut. Meanwhile, legal professionals in England and Wales express skepticism about AI assistants in courts, arguing they cannot substitute for essential human resources and funding. The UK is planning a trial of these AI assistants in crown courts to address case backlogs. AI
